环境健康危害指数(Environmental Health Hazard Index) **摘要** 环境健康危害暴露指数用于汇总社区层面的有害毒素潜在暴露情况。潜在健康危害暴露为标准化美国环境保护署(U.S. Environmental Protection Agency,简称EPA)估算的空气质量致癌危害(记为$c$)、呼吸道危害(记为$r$)以及神经危害(记为$n$)的线性组合,其中$i$以人口普查片区为索引单位。 【居中对齐】计算公式如下:[对应公式图片] 其中,$ar{x}$(对应均值图片)代表均值,标准误差(对应EHHI_Errors图片)则基于全国分布完成估算。 **结果解读** 指数数值先经反转处理,随后在全国范围内进行百分位排名,取值区间为0至100。指数数值越高,代表人体接触有害健康毒素的暴露程度越低,即对应社区的环境质量越好。本数据集的统计单元为人口普查街区组。 **数据来源**:2014年全国空气毒素评估(National Air Toxics Assessment, NATA)数据。 相关AFFH-T地方政府、公共住房机构(Public Housing Agency,简称PHA)及州级表格/地图:表格12;地图13。 **参考文献**:https://www.epa.gov/ttn/atw/natamain/ 如需了解更多关于环境健康危害指数的相关信息,请访问:https://www.hud.gov/program_offices/fair_housing_equal_opp/affh ; https://www.hud.gov/sites/dfiles/FHEO/documents/AFFH-T-Data-Documentation-AFFHT0006-July-2020.pdf。如需咨询本数据集的空间归因相关问题,请发送邮件至 GISHelpdesk@hud.gov。 覆盖日期:2020年7月
